Output d66bf57937498c6f33a83199cb9218dc57e5163582512a2979b63d60bb3839e5:1

value
1519630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71dad663f2cd321dd064738acc6e59117c1ca2d7 OP_EQUAL
address
3C52SKAjcykX9G4Nru6KX5Xsi42wSnaAsW
transaction
d66bf57937498c6f33a83199cb9218dc57e5163582512a2979b63d60bb3839e5
spent
true